Adeptus, part of Crete Professionals Alliance, is an independent full-service accounting and advisory firm. We are hiring an IT Administrator to join our team. We are committed to fostering a supportive and inclusive workplace where every team member can thrive.
Summary Seasoned IT Administrator with a strong foundation in end‑user support and a proven track record of advancing from frontline help desk operations into full systems administration. Adept at managing infrastructure, improving IT processes, and delivering reliable, secure technology services. Brings deep hands‑on experience with troubleshooting, system configuration, and user enablement, paired with a broader strategic understanding of network, server, and cloud environments.
Key Responsibilities Systems & Infrastructure Administration
Maintain, configure, and support on‑premises and cloud‑based systems including servers, virtualization platforms, storage, identity management, and endpoint management tools.
Administer Microsoft 365, Active Directory, Azure AD, Intune/Endpoint Manager, and related enterprise services.
Ensure system uptime, performance, and reliability by proactively monitoring and resolving issues before they impact operations.
Network Management
Support and maintain LAN/WAN infrastructure, firewalls, wireless networks, VPN, and network security appliances.
Perform configuration changes, firmware updates, and troubleshooting of connectivity and performance issues.
Security & Compliance
Implement and enforce security best practices, including patch management, MFA, least‑privilege access, and endpoint protection.
Assist with audits, compliance initiatives (e.g., SOC 2, HIPAA, PCI), and incident response activities.
IT Service & Support Leadership
Provide Tier 2 and Tier 3 technical support after progressing from Help Desk roles.
Mentor junior support staff and help develop standard operating procedures and knowledge‑base documentation.
Drive continuous improvement in help desk workflows, ticket resolution processes, and user experience.
Project Implementation
Lead or participate in IT projects such as system upgrades, migrations, hardware refresh cycles, and cloud adoption initiatives.
Coordinate with vendors, internal stakeholders, and cross‑functional teams to ensure project success.
Asset, Patch, & Configuration Management
Oversee hardware/software lifecycle management including procurement, deployment, inventory tracking, and decommissioning.
Manage OS and application patching schedules and automated update systems.
Required Skills & Qualifications
Proven experience progressing from Help Desk Support to systems administration roles.
Strong knowledge of Windows Server environments, Microsoft 365, Active Directory, networking fundamentals, and endpoint management.
Experience with virtualization (VMware/Hyper‑V), backup systems, and cloud technologies such as Azure or AWS.
Excellent troubleshooting, analytical, and communication skills.
Ability to work independently and manage multiple priorities in a dynamic environment.
Preferred Skills
Scripting skills (PowerShell, Bash, Python).
Experience with SIEM, IDS/IPS, and advanced security tools.
Familiarity with ITIL practices, documentation standards, and ticketing platforms (Jira, ServiceNow, etc.).
